> Naaah!  I have several earlier versions (including some betas) and
> MUCH prefer v.9 .  I was a beta tester for v.9 when my ACE2200 was
> my # 1 machine. It's still my favorite utility even though # 1 is
> now a //GS and # 2 is a 'real' //E.  Except for one 'leetle' bug in
> sorting directories, it's pretty damn bullet proof.
> No ProDOS-8 program can deal with forked files so use C2P with
> caution in your //GS.

	Actually, there is a bug in the v9.x versions that trashes your hard
drive. I'd be very careful about using it if you own one. I don't remember
what the exact bug is, but another beta tester had reported it and Central
Point ignored him. The problem has also happened to me and luckilly, Prosel
bailed me out.
